What Are Color by Number Hello Kitty Coloring Pages?

These aren’t your typical coloring pages. These are pixel art mystery pictures. That means each page looks like a grid of numbers at first glance. But as you fill in the bright colors based on the number key, a picture or the free printable Hello Kitty coloring pages slowly appears.

In this printable pack, you’ll get eight different Sanrio characters from the World of Hello Kitty:

  • Hello Kitty with her icon red bow
  • Keroppi
  • My Melody
  • Kuromi
  • Cinnamoroll
  • Pompompurin
  • Bad Badtz-Maru
  • Pachacco

Each page includes a color-by-number code. All you have to do is match the numbers with the correct colors. It’s fun, relaxing, and a little bit like solving a puzzle!

Variations for Using the Printable

One great thing about these pages is how flexible they are. You can easily change up how you use them depending on your needs.

Adjust the Color Palette

If your child doesn’t have all the colors listed on the sheet, no problem! Just substitute with similar colors. The image will still come through, and it adds a little creativity to the process.

Laminate for Reuse

Print the sheets, laminate them, and use dry-erase markers. This way, kids can color, wipe, and redo the picture whenever they want. It’s great for classrooms or busy households or even taking the Hello Kitty Characters on the go to color in the car or while traveling.

Group Coloring

Cut the picture into four sections and let multiple kids color one part each. Then tape the pieces back together on a piece of poster board to reveal the final masterpiece. Teamwork!

Common Questions About Color by Number Hello Kitty Coloring Pages

Are these color by number Hello Kitty coloring pages free?
Yes! This full set of eight pixel art pages is completely free to download and print for personal use.

What age are these coloring pages good for?
These pages are great for kids ages 5 and up. The numbered boxes require some reading and fine motor control, so younger kids might need a little help at first. Older kids can definitely get in the fun of these coloring Hello Kitty pages too!

Can adults use them too?
Absolutely. Many adults love color-by-number pages as a way to relax. These Hello Kitty designs are simple yet fun, making them a great quick project.

What if I don’t have all the colors listed in the key?
Feel free to improvise! Swap out colors or create your own palette. The final image might look slightly different, but that’s part of the fun.

What materials work best?
Crayons, markers, and colored pencils all work well. Just be sure your printer paper is thick enough if using markers, so it doesn’t bleed through.
